    This has become a pretty normal process the last few years - the "fall finale". The thinking is people will be more annoyed by frequent breaks for repeats. Most shows do 22 to 24 episodes in a season, but the actual TV season is 35 weeks.

    The choice is to take a complete break for a longer stretch, or to keep interrupting the flow with reruns (more often what happens with sitcoms). It's still a risky move, and judging from the responses here, it shows they stand to lose a chunk of the hard won audience they got for a new show by doing it.

    It's not as if they're going to raise the budget and allow any show to make enough episodes to fill the season with. That hasn't happened since the 60s.
